Vision & Statement of Faith
In the spirit of love, hope and inclusion, Penhurst Retreat Centre has adopted an amended version of the Evangelical Alliance statement of faith, to act as an anchor and inspiration for our spiritual identity and belief. Inspired by the life, teaching and mission of Jesus, it is our policy to welcome all as our guests regardless of their personal position or beliefs. We believe in the ministry of hospitality and this extends to both those we agree and disagree with. Relationship is by far the most powerful way of persuading anyone and we reach out in love to everyone.
we have a clear spiritual identity shaped by the Gospel of Jesus Christ, and seeks to retain this through succeeding generations; to that end we ask trustees and senior staff to agree the statements below are true and should be expressed in love.
We believe that the central Biblical message is the c oming of God s kingdom , with Jesus enthroned as our loving King and we as His people. Everything we do is aimed at building this kingdom.
Our Statement of Faith
In particular we believe in:
- The one true loving God who lives eternally in three persons the Father, the Son and the Holy Spirit.
- The love, grace and sovereignty of God in creating, sustaining, ruling, redeeming and judging the world.
- The divine inspiration and supreme authority of Jesus expressed in the Old and New Testament scriptures, which are the written word of God fully trustworthy for our mission, faith and conduct.
- The dignity of all people, made male and female in God s image to love, be holy and care for creation, yet corrupted by sin, which incurs divine wrath and judgement.
- The incarnation of God s eternal Son, the Lord Jesus Christ born of the Virgin Mary; truly divine and truly human, yet without sin.
- The atoning sacrifice of Christ on the cross: dying in our place, paying the price of sin and defeating evil, so reconciling us with God.
- The bodily resurrection of Christ, the first fruits of our resurrection; His ascension to the Father, and His reign and mediation as the only Saviour of the world.
- The justification of sinners solely by the grace of God through faith in Christ.
- The ministry of God the Holy Spirit, who leads us to repentance, unites us with Christ through new birth, empowers our discipleship and enables our witness.
- The Church, the body of Christ both local and universal, the priesthood of all believers given life by the Spirit and endowed with the Spirit s gifts to worship God and proclaim the Gospel, make disciples, promoting justice and love.
- The personal and visible return of Jesus Christ to fulfil the purposes of God, who will raise all people to judgement, bring eternal life to the redeemed and eternal condemnation to the lost, and establish a new heaven and new earth.
- That God ordained good works for all His children to do, therefore true faith and belief must be worked out in deeds.
- That truth should never be separated from love, so we seek to do nothing unless it be loving. 1 Corinthians 13 is our shield and inspiration, that we may never insist on truth apart from love.
